Constraints of data

There are numerous restrictions to presenting matchmaking users as data to have this study; although not, we believe your experts considerably surpass the costs. We have been extremely concerned with the fresh categorizations away from race and you may ethnicity provided by the LatamDate-app fresh dating site because these classes conflate battle and you can ethnicity, is actually excessively greater, and you will polish over far social and you will cultural assortment. This really is perhaps most obviously towards classes “Asian” and you will “Latino,” and this almost certainly range from the greatest diversity in terms of nationhood, ethnicity and community. We have been in addition to struggling to detect the amount to which individual daters choose that have racial–ethnic subcultures. This will be particularly important to have understandings of one’s muscles and you can charm as attitudes out-of appeal are different from the society (Crandall and you will ).

Some other concern about having fun with on the web daters’ self claimed users is that this article are falsified-daters are most likely seeking prove from the best white and could be ready to fabricate information. This, but not, isn’t expected to provides an excellent grave effect on this research. Cornwell and Lundgren (2001) find that folks are somewhat more likely to misrepresent by themselves on the web than in people, but these trend don’t are very different somewhat by the gender. It is reasonably unrealistic that they’ll establish incorrect profile of its preferences for possible times, once the seriously reacting such questions provides to help you filter men and women whom an on-line dater doesn’t need to big date. In the event that daters carry out rest, chances are to be about their individual figure, perhaps not you particular they demand out-of potential times. To attempt to target so it opportunity and reduce ple daters which have photographs to limit the knowledge to which daters can get misrepresent their own system versions or other real attributes. Ellison mais aussi al. (2006) questioned internet daters and discovered that daters be he’s generally sincere because they desired meeting the folks which respond to its pages directly. Although not, after they would rest it is usually regarding the very own pounds otherwise years, which they indicate misrepresenting just somewhat, so you’re able to fit into another type of, however, similar, category that they end up being is far more confident or usually gather significantly more dates. Responding compared to that chance, while using good dater’s very own frame given that a processing changeable, i categorize wider, in place of specific, frame categories of the collection the newest ten broad categories with the four: Quick, Average, Athletic and enormous.

Once the cons these types of study are very important to see, some great benefits of by using these analysis much provide more benefits than such can cost you. This is also true given that online dating becomes an even more prevalent way to fulfill dates; more than one-third out-of adults just who go surfing and are also trying intimate partners have gone so you can relationship other sites (Madden and you can Lenhart 2006). Then, given that relationships rates decline and you will non-marital partnerships improve (Bumpass et al. 1991; Schoen and you will Standish 2001), relationship choices may be a more right measure of mate choice than just relationship consequences.

Achievement

Our very own findings show that competition–ethnicity and you will gender influence physical stature preferences; men and whites is actually significantly more most likely than simply women and you may low-whites for like preferences. We believe white male daters’ body type choice is swayed alot more from the principal media pictures of better body products than simply are those out-of non-white male daters mainly because photographs was predominately out-of whites; the pictures of the most readily useful feminine human anatomy are more constrained to possess women compared to guys; and other cultural information contend to help you figure the latest needs away from low-whites. Even in the event previous work with their outline numbers, otherwise discover samples, provides inconsistent findings, our examination of real relationships options show that non-light dudes, including African-American and you will Latino dudes, try never as likely than simply is actually white guys so you can prefer good day into ideal thin body type. Overall, guys of colour are more discover than just white men so you’re able to relationships mediocre women, and you may African Americans and you can Latinos, yet not Asians, was far more probably like a heavy otherwise heavier muscles kind of.
